    Xbox and Windows Integration

    Microsoft is making significant strides in integrating Xbox and Windows game development more closely. This move aims to create a more seamless experience for game developers and players alike. By leveraging the power of Windows, developers can now create games that can run on both Xbox and Windows devices, expanding the reach of their games to a broader audience.

  • Cross-platform compatibility: With the integration of Xbox and Windows, developers can now create games that can run on both platforms, allowing them to reach a wider audience and increase their revenue streams.
  • Shared resources: Developers can share resources, such as game engines and tools, between Xbox and Windows, reducing development costs and increasing efficiency.
  • Easier game testing: With the ability to test games on both Xbox and Windows, developers can identify and fix bugs more easily, resulting in a higher quality gaming experience.Xbox and Windows Integration: What Does it Mean for Players? The integration of Xbox and Windows game development has significant implications for players. With the ability to play games on both platforms, players can now enjoy a wider range of games and experiences.
